Tashkent Park is a shady, pleasant neighborhood park featuring picnic tables, a wooden arbor, chairs, and a sculpture. Tashkent Park is named after the city of Tashkent, Uzbekistan, which is one of Seattle's International Sister Cities.

Warren G. Magnuson Park Off Leash Area

Magnuson's off-leash area is 8.6 acres in size. It's a location where city hounds can play with their friends in Seattle's largest fully-fenced dog park. This off-leash facility is the only one with water access (Lake Washington's freshwater shoreline) inside city borders. The park features a wide, mostly flat play area, a winding route with various open sections and scenic changes along the way, and lots of space for dog owners and their dogs of all ages to "work out." The trail is mostly made up of compact gravel and is wheelchair accessible. Within the main dog park, this off-leash section has a small and shy dog area. Golden Gardens Off Leash Area

This famous park in Ballard on Puget Sound offers spectacular views of Puget Sound and the Olympic Mountains. Two wetlands, a small circle route, and a repaired northern beach are all part of this park. Walking along a mountainous coastline, hiking through woodland trails, sunbathing on sandy beaches, fishing from a pier, and a boat launch with 300 feet of shoreline are all available at Golden Gardens. In the higher northern section of the park, there is also an off-leash area for dogs. According to the Seattle Municipal Code, dogs are not permitted on beaches or in children's play areas in Seattle parks.
